Determiners

2
every (każdy) + singular noun
E.g. Every child needs a mother.
3
all (wszyscy, cały) + plural/uncountable noun
E.g. All children learn through play.
All this noise makes me nervous.
4
!!! All of + the/this/that/these/those/my etc.
E.g. All of his friends are artists.

8
no (żaden) + any noun
The rest of the sentence must be POSITIVE!
E.g. I have no money. (uncountable)
I have no ancestors in Argentina. (countable plural)
The guest had no suitcase. (countable singular)
9
any (jakiś/żaden) + any noun)
In questions or negative sentences!
Have you got any ideas?
The guide didn't know any person there.
I won't show him any respect!
10
some (kilka,trochę) + plural / uncountable noun
Usually in positive sentences!
E.g. There were some protesters outside the office.
I need some peace and quiet.
!!! Would you like some coffee? (polite offer - we want to hear 'yes')

12
some / any of the, this etc. , my etc.
E.g. Some of the protesters were violent.
The panel didn't like any of our suggestions.

19
most (większość) + countable plural / uncountable noun
E.g. Most people like chocolate.
We get most advice from my relatives from Greece.
20
most of (większość z) + the, this etc., my etc.
E.g. Most of these people are immigrants.
I copied most of the information from our website.
21
many (wiele) + plural countable noun
E.g. There were many reasons why we resigned from travelling.
22
many of (wiele spośród) + the, this etc, my etc
Many of my nephews live in the USA.
23
much (dużo) + uncountable noun
E.g. How much pollution does the average person cause?
24
much of (wiele z) + the, this etc., my etc.
E.g. Much of my hope comes from praying.
25
a lot of + plural countable / uncountable noun
I have a lot of time.
They use a lot of resources.

30
few (mało) + plural countable noun
E.g. I'm sad I have few friends.
31
a few (kilku) + plural countable noun
E.g. I have a few good friends.
32
little (mało) + uncountable noun
E.g. Oh, no! There's so little time left!
33
a little (trochę) + uncountable noun
E.g. I need a little sleep.

38
both of (obaj) + plural noun
E.g. Both of my parents work in advertising.
39
none of (żaden) + plural noun (more than two)
E.g. There were many ideas. None of them was good.
40
neither of (żaden) + plural noun (two things)
E.g. Neither of my parents works in advertising.
41
either of (któryś, każdy) + plural noun (two things)
You can use either of my cars. (I have two)
